What the record establishes

The information is as of 30 August 2026. Where a figure comes from a dissertation rather than a journal version, the entry says so.

The measured differences between advisers are differences in what clients hold

On the records where individual advisers can be told apart, advisers differ from one another in the portfolios their clients end up with. In the Canadian dealer records, which adviser a client has predicts the client's share of growth assets better than everything the dealer knows about the client, and an adviser's own portfolio is among the strongest predictors of the client's. At one Swiss bank, purchases made after advice returned less over the following year than the same client's own purchases. In one United States retirement plan, broker clients earned less on their portfolios than matched default portfolios. Each of those studies is set out with its figures, its source and its limitation on the State of Research page. What none of them measures is a household outcome, such as wealth, set against which adviser the household had: the record establishes that advisers differ in what their clients hold and what those holdings cost, and it does not cover a ranking of advisers on client outcomes.

Source the entries "What advisers did to allocations, and what they held themselves", "Advised trades against the same client's own trades" and "Brokers measured against a default fund" on State of Research, each with its document and its limitation.

The three datasets are Canadian mutual fund dealers, one Swiss retail bank and one United States university retirement plan. All three are commission-paid or bank channels, and none is Australian.

The association between advice and later wealth, where it has been checked further

Two datasets carry a measured association between having an adviser and a household's later wealth, and in both the association changed when it was checked against an alternative explanation. The first is the British panel treated on the State of Research page: the association there was largest in the first two years after advice, became too imprecise to read at longer horizons, and was reported as not clearly different from zero once people who received a lump sum were excluded.

The second is from the United States. The Asset and Health Dynamics among the Oldest Old survey, a national panel of older Americans, asked respondents in 1993: "Do you have a financial advisor who helps make decisions?" Among respondents aged 60 and older, 13.09% said yes. Doctoral research at Texas Tech University modelled net worth in each of seven later waves, 1995 to 2008, against that one answer, on a logarithmic scale so that the comparison is proportional rather than in dollars, adjusting for baseline net worth, income, education, cognition and demographics, and reports that having an advisor in 1993 is positively related to later net worth, especially more than a decade later. The same dissertation's own tables carry three measurements that bear on how to read that. The two groups were far apart before any follow-up: mean 1993 net worth was $143,497 for respondents without an advisor and $357,686 for respondents with one, about 2.5 times as much. The dissertation's own comparison of changes in inflation-adjusted net worth finds the two groups' changes significantly different only over the first three follow-ups, to 1995, 1998 and 2000; over the longer spans it reports the changes as not significantly different, meaning that at the precision the comparison had, the difference between the two groups' growth in wealth could not be told apart from zero. And the number of respondents in the analyses falls from 6,183 in 1995 to 1,846 in 2008, in a sample whose largest age group was in their seventies at the start: most of the starting respondents die before the last waves, so the longest-span comparisons describe the minority who lived longest. The dissertation checks this by re-running the models on only the respondents still alive in 2008, and reports that among those survivors, having an advisor in 1993 is significant for later net worth only in 2004, 2006 and 2008. The advisor question was never asked again after 1993, so every one of those comparisons rests on the assumption that the single 1993 answer still described the household up to fifteen years later; the study measures nothing about whether respondents kept, changed or lost their advisers over those years, and offers no basis for the assumption. In the experience of this page's author, that assumption has a particular shape at these ages: adviser relationships are stable once clients are in their seventies or older, and the major change comes when the children of clients begin managing their parents' affairs, typically in the clients' eighties unless dementia sets in earlier, when a substantial proportion remove the adviser. United States industry research on the neighbouring event points the same way: Cerulli Associates reports that more than 70% of heirs are likely to fire or change financial advisors on inheriting. The dissertation's author writes that clients of financial advisors may be inherently different from individuals who do not use professional financial advice, and that these unobserved differences might also be driving the results.

Source Cummings, "Three Essays on the Use and Value of Financial Advice", doctoral dissertation, Texas Tech University, May 2013, essay three ("The Impact of Financial Advisors on the Subsequent Wealth of Older Adults"), Tables 4.1, 4.5 and 4.6 and the discussion. The essay also circulates as a working paper by Cummings and James; the figures here were read from the dissertation. The heirs sentence is Cerulli Associates' own, from its release of 19 July 2021 announcing the Cerulli Edge, U.S. Advisor Edition, third quarter 2021 issue; it is industry research about inheritance in the United States, named here beside the author's experience rather than as a measurement of the Australian event described.

One survey question is the whole exposure measure, so a first appointment and a twenty-year relationship are the same answer. The study reports a difference that remains after adjusting for the characteristics the survey measured, and adjusting can remove only the differences that were measured; a household two and a half times wealthier at the start differs in more than the survey records. The sample is United States respondents aged 60 and older, drawing down rather than accumulating.

The two studies are observational studies, which only in rare cases, and not in these cases, can establish causality. The studies show an association, and an association could disappear when another cause is found. One example is that the wealthier a person is, the more likely they are to appoint an adviser. If that is the case, then the causality runs the other way: wealth appoints advisers. Advisers may still make clients even wealthier but it is then not clear if even an association between advisers and increased wealth exists in these datasets.

No public dataset separates advised from unadvised behaviour in a market fall, and the reason is structural

What is known about the 2020 fall in Australia is aggregate. The Reserve Bank of Australia's review of the episode reports that around half of the increase in superannuation funds' cash holdings over the March quarter of 2020 came from members switching out of higher-risk investment options into cash; that the switching amounted to about 1.5% of funds under management for the system as a whole and, in data collected from 30 funds, ran as high as 3–4% of funds under management for several large funds and 8% for one medium-sized fund; that these flows were larger than in previous market dislocations, including the global financial crisis; and that the switching was driven by a small pool of active members, generally closer to retirement and with larger average balances. Switches out of default MySuper products were small. The document does not record whether any member had an adviser.

The Australian Prudential Regulation Authority (APRA) published its own account of the same period from its pandemic data collection. Its figures for members switching back out of cash in the June quarter of 2020 name the collection's boundary in the same sentence: the flows are reported "excluding platform products where switching functionality is not available without the use of an intermediary cash account". A platform is an account administration service through which an investor holds investments across many funds and managers; the administrator holds the account records. So the switching series that exists excludes the accounts held through platforms, and the account records that sit with the platform administrators are not in any public collection. What building a study from those records would take, and the questions that would have to be settled first, are set out in the questions section of the State of Research page. No dataset separating advised from unadvised behaviour in a fall was found, either in Australia or elsewhere; the search behind that absence is recorded on the same page. Reviewing a wrap account provider's records could be a worthwhile research undertaking: comparing the switching behaviour of advised clients against the small number of unadvised clients these platforms hold, comparing that behaviour against the Reserve Bank data, and then modelling the wealth effect of the measures taken. Wrap account providers used in Australia are Macquarie Bank, BT Panorama, Netwealth, Colonial First State, AMP North and others. The same comparison could be made within industry funds, comparing the behaviour of the small number of clients recorded as advised in the funds' own records against the unadvised clients.

Sources "Box C: What Did 2020 Reveal About Liquidity Challenges Facing Superannuation Funds?", Reserve Bank of Australia, Financial Stability Review, April 2021; "The superannuation Early Release Scheme: Insights from APRA's Pandemic Data Collection", APRA Insight, Issue Four 2020. APRA's own address for that article stopped resolving some time before 30 August 2026, so the link is the Internet Archive's capture of APRA's address, of 7 March 2026, which is where the article was read.

Both documents are regulators' aggregates of fund-level reporting; neither is a study of members, and neither records advice.

The author's research, and the methods behind it

The author of these Tools, Dr Christoph Schnelle, wrote his doctoral thesis on the matching question in medicine: how much of the difference in patients' outcomes belongs to the individual medical doctor, beyond the intervention and all known factors. His two systematic reviews, one of surgeons and one of doctors other than surgeons, are covered on the State of Research page.

How the doctors' effect on patients' physical health was measured

The statistic, i.e. the number the reviews chiefly collected, was the intra-class correlation coefficient (ICC): the share of the total variation in a patient outcome that is attributed to the doctors, after accounting for what is known about patients and doctors. Where the data records a hospital level, the hospital has its own share, and the shares of all levels add up to the whole. An ICC of 4% on an outcome means that 4% of the total variation in that outcome is associated with which doctor the patient had.

One of the published studies in the systematic reviews shows the measure at work on two professions at once. Across 110,769 cardiac operations at ten United Kingdom centres over ten years, with 127 consultant surgeons and 190 consultant anaesthetists, the patient's own risk accounted for 95.75% of the variation in deaths in hospital, the surgeon for an ICC of 4.00% and the anaesthetist for an ICC of 0.25% of that same variation, the three shares adding up to the whole: the same operations, the same patients, two practitioner roles estimated in one model, one carrying a measurable share and the other close to none. The authors conclude that mortality after cardiac surgery is primarily determined by the patient, with small but significant differences between surgeons, and that anaesthetists did not appear to affect mortality. Though, in the judgement of this page's author, if post-operative pain had been measured, the influence of the anaesthetist may have been much stronger.

Source Papachristofi, Sharples, Mackay, Nashef, Fletcher and Klein, "The contribution of the anaesthetist to risk-adjusted mortality after cardiac surgery", Anaesthesia 71(2), 2016. The figures here were read from the published abstract as indexed by Europe PMC on 30 August 2026.

One kind of surgery, one outcome, British hospitals. On other outcomes and in other settings the two reviews treated on the State of Research page found the share differing by outcome, by specialty and by adjustment.

The methodological review

Source Schnelle and Jones, "The Doctors' Effect on Patients' Physical Health Outcomes Beyond the Intervention: A Methodological Review", Clinical Epidemiology 14, 2022, pages 851 to 870, from the same doctoral work; its recommendations section and its Table 4.

The review is about doctors and its studies were all conducted in North America or Europe, which is the review's own stated limitation. It recommends how a practitioner effect could be measured and reported where grouped records exist; it does not cover whether Australian advice records of that shape exist or could be obtained.
